In this Technology Reseller News podcast, RabbitRun Founder and CTO Pat Saavedra discusses the partnership and the opportunity it creates for MSPs, service providers and telecom resellers. RabbitRun offers an integrated platform that brings together Always-On Internet, enterprise-class SD-WAN, cybersecurity, voice survivability, POTS replacement and business continuity. The goal is to help businesses remain connected and operational when internet connections, networks or other critical infrastructure fail. For channel partners, Saavedra says the opportunity extends well beyond simply selling another connectivity product. Partners can use RabbitRun to address real customer concerns surrounding uptime, security and operational resilience while creating new sources of recurring managed-services revenue. As more business applications move to the cloud, internet connectivity has become essential infrastructure. A failed connection can interrupt voice services, payment processing, customer support, remote access and other core operations. RabbitRun is designed to identify network problems and move traffic to an available connection, helping businesses continue operating with minimal disruption. The platform also gives partners greater visibility into customer networks, allowing them to identify performance issues, manage connectivity and provide ongoing support. That creates a more proactive relationship in which the partner is helping protect the customer’s business rather than simply responding after something goes wrong. The conversation also explores the growing importance of voice survivability. Businesses may have backup internet connections but still discover that their voice systems fail during an outage. RabbitRun helps partners address that gap by protecting both data and voice communications as part of a broader continuity strategy. POTS replacement represents another opportunity. As traditional analog lines become more expensive and difficult to maintain, businesses need alternatives for services such as alarms, elevators, fax machines and emergency communications. RabbitRun enables partners to incorporate those requirements into a modern managed connectivity offering. By joining the Crexendo Ecosystem Vendor Partner Program, RabbitRun becomes more accessible to a large community of service providers already delivering communications through Crexendo and the NetSapiens platform. Saavedra says this gives partners an opportunity to expand the value of their existing customer relationships. Rather than competing only on voice seats or connectivity pricing, they can provide a broader solution built around reliability, security and business continuity. For MSPs and communications providers, the message is straightforward: protecting the customer’s ability to remain connected can become both an essential service and a meaningful recurring revenue opportunity.
